It Is What You Make of It

Recommend
CEO approval
Business Outlook

Pros

It is what you make of it. If you just do your tasks you will learn only that. If you take initiative and do the parts of the job that are tedious and difficult you may be exposed to more interesting work.

Cons

As an intern you don't want to be working from home at all. However, unfortunately your colleagues may be working from home which may reduce opportunities for networking.
